In rabbinic law, however, not only is the marriage of a man and his sisters daughter permitted, the rabbis even promote it as an ideal marriage (b.Sanhedrin76b). If one pair of siblings is married to another pair of siblings, the siblings-in-law are thus doubly related, each of the four both through ones spouse and through ones sibling, while the children of the two couples are double cousins. In contrast, in their early history, Karaite Jews, who do not accept the authority of Talmudic law, greatly extended the prohibition, including to unions that involve a man and a woman of the same generation.
